1.2 SST’s CompactFlash Card Product Offering
The SST48CFxxx High CompactFlash product family is available in 8 to 256 MByte densities. The following table
shows the specific capacity, default number of cylinder heads, sectors and cylinders for each product line.

2.1 Electrical Description
The CompactFlash card functions in three basic modes: 1) PC Card ATA using I/O mode, 2) PC Card ATA using Memory
mode and 3) True IDE mode, which is compatible with most disk drives. The configuration of the CompactFlash card will be
controlled using the standard PCMCIA configuration registers starting at address 200H in the Attribute Memory space of the
storage card or for True IDE mode, pin 9 being grounded.
Table 2-2 describes the I/O signals. Signals whose source is the host are designated as inputs while signals that the Com-
pactFlash card sources are outputs. The CompactFlash card logic levels conform to those specified in the PCMCIA Release
2.1 and CFA Specification Rev. 1.4. As shown in
Table 2-2, each signal has three possible operating modes: 1) PC Card
Memory, 2) PC Card I/O and 3) True IDE. All outputs from the card are totem pole except the data bus signals which are bi-
directional tri-state. Refer to Section
2.3 for definitions of Input and Output type.
